The Growing Importance of Research Consultancies in Ghana

Research consultancies are becoming an integral part of Ghana’s development landscape, providing valuable insights and data-driven solutions across various sectors. The rise of these specialized services reflects a broader trend towards evidence-based decision-making and strategic planning. This article explores the significant role of research consultancies in Ghana and the trends driving their growth.

1. Enhanced Data-Driven Decision Making

In today’s information age, data is king. Research consultancies in Ghana are harnessing the power of data to inform decision-making processes in both the public and private sectors. They offer expertise in collecting, analyzing, and interpreting data to provide actionable insights. This shift towards data-driven decision-making ensures that policies and strategies are based on robust evidence, leading to more effective outcomes.

2. Diverse Sector Engagement

Research consultancies are engaged across various sectors, including healthcare, education, agriculture, finance, and social development. Their work spans from market research for businesses to policy research for government agencies. By addressing sector-specific challenges with tailored research, these consultancies help organizations and institutions achieve their goals more efficiently.

3. Technological Integration

The integration of advanced technologies in research methodologies is another key trend. Research consultancies are utilizing digital tools and platforms for data collection and analysis. Technologies such as Geographic Information Systems (GIS), mobile surveys, and big data analytics enhance the accuracy and efficiency of research activities. This technological integration also facilitates real-time data collection and analysis, enabling quicker and more informed decision-making.

4. Focus on Local Context

Understanding the local context is crucial for the success of any research initiative. Research consultancies in Ghana are prioritizing local context by employing researchers who are familiar with the cultural, social, and economic landscapes of the regions they study. This localized approach ensures that research findings are relevant and applicable, leading to more effective interventions and policies.

5. Capacity Building and Training

Capacity building is an essential component of the services offered by research consultancies. They provide training and development programs to enhance the research skills of local professionals. This focus on capacity building not only improves the quality of research but also fosters a culture of continuous learning and development within the research community.

6. Partnerships and Collaborations

Collaborative efforts between research consultancies, academic institutions, government agencies, and international organizations are on the rise. These partnerships leverage the strengths of each entity, combining academic rigor with practical expertise. Such collaborations enhance the quality and impact of research projects, leading to more comprehensive and multidisciplinary approaches to problem-solving.

7. Sustainability and Development Goals

Research consultancies are increasingly aligning their work with global sustainability and development goals. By focusing on areas such as environmental sustainability, public health, and social equity, these consultancies contribute to the broader agenda of sustainable development. Their research supports initiatives that aim to achieve the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) in Ghana.

8. Impact Evaluation and Monitoring

The demand for impact evaluation and monitoring is growing, with organizations seeking to measure the effectiveness of their programs and interventions. Research consultancies provide specialized services in this area, helping organizations assess the outcomes and impacts of their initiatives. This enables continuous improvement and accountability, ensuring that resources are utilized effectively.

9. Policy Influence and Advocacy

Research consultancies play a pivotal role in shaping public policy. Through rigorous research and evidence-based recommendations, they influence policy decisions at local, regional, and national levels. By providing policymakers with credible and reliable data, these consultancies contribute to the development of informed and effective policies.

Conclusion

The rise of research consultancies in Ghana signifies a growing appreciation for the value of evidence-based decision-making. These consultancies are driving advancements across various sectors by providing critical insights and data-driven solutions. As they continue to evolve, their impact on Ghana’s development landscape will undoubtedly increase, fostering innovation, efficiency, and sustainable growth.
